在Web开发中,jQuery AJAX是一种常用的技术,用于在不需要重新加载整个页面的情况下与服务器交换数据和更新部分网页内容。然而,在处理AJAX请求时,我们可能会遇到参数为null的情况,这可能会...
在Web开发中,jQuery AJAX是一种常用的技术,用于在不需要重新加载整个页面的情况下与服务器交换数据和更新部分网页内容。然而,在处理AJAX请求时,我们可能会遇到参数为null的情况,这可能会导致请求失败或者数据处理的错误。本文将深入探讨jQuery AJAX参数为null的原因,并提供一些数据处理与调试技巧。
以下是一个简单的jQuery AJAX请求示例,用于从服务器获取数据:
$.ajax({ url: 'example.com/data', type: 'GET', data: { param1: 'value1', param2: 'value2' }, success: function(response) { console.log('Data received:', response); }, error: function(xhr, status, error) { console.error('Error:', error); }
});在这个示例中,data对象包含了请求参数param1和param2。
jQuery AJAX参数为null可能是由于多种原因导致的。通过仔细检查参数设置、验证参数类型、监控请求取消以及使用调试技巧,我们可以有效地处理和调试这类问题。掌握这些技巧将有助于你在Web开发中更高效地处理AJAX请求。